The 3 months correlation between Templeton and Guggenheim is -0.21.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ding Templeton Global Bond and Guggenheim Macro Opportunities in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on Guggenheim Macro Opp and Templeton Global is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Templeton Global Bond are associated (or correlated) with Guggenheim Macro. Pair Trading with Templeton Global and Guggenheim Macro

The main advantage of trading using opposite Templeton Global and Guggenheim Macro posit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Templeton Global position performs unexpectedly, Guggenheim Macro can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in Guggenheim Macro will offset losses from the drop in Guggenheim Macro's long position.
The idea behind Templeton Global Bond and Guggenheim Macro Opportunities p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side). This can be achieved by designing a pairs trade with two highly correlated stocks or equities that operate in a similar space or sector, making it possible to obtain profits through simple and relatively low-risk investment.
